
* html body {
	scrollbar-face-color: #ffffff;
	scrollbar-arrow-color: #DCD8AD;
	scrollbar-track-color: #ffffff;
}
body {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
}
.tableau td .tablo_cadre td{
border:1px solid #000000;
}
.tableau td .tablo_energie td{
	border:1px solid #CACC02;
}
.tableau td .tablo_demarches td{
	border:1px solid #FF9999;
}

.tableau td .tablo_dechet td{
	border:1px solid #6699CC;
}
.tableau td {
border:0;
}
.tab_contact td{
	border:solid 1px #000;
}


.tabloCadreB {
border:1px solid #C3DFFA;
}
.tabloCadreC {
border:1px solid #FF9900;
}
.text {
font-size:10px;
font-family:verdana ;
}
.textPC {
font-size:9px;
font-family: Verdana, Arial, Helvetica, sans-serif;
color:#555555;
}
.text:hover{
font-size:10px;
text-decoration:none;
}

.SousTitre {
color:#000000;
font-size: 12pt;
font-weight: bold; 
}

span.text font strong{
	font-size:14px;
}

a.grosLien, a.grosLien:hover {
color:#000000;
font-size: 12pt;
font-weight: bold; 
}
a.grosLien:hover {
	text-decoration: none;
}

.SousTitre2 {
color:#000000;
font-size: 10pt; 
}

a {
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: underline;
color:#000000;
font-size: 10pt;
}
a:hover {
font-family: Verdana, Arial, Helvetica, sans-serif;
color:#000;
text-decoration:underline;
font-size: 10pt;
}

.LienCentre {
font-family: Verdana, Arial, Helvetica, sans-serif;
text-decoration: underline;
color:#000000;
font-size: 10px;
}
.LienCentre:hover {
font-family: Verdana, Arial, Helvetica, sans-serif;
color:#E4E580;
text-decoration:underline;
font-size: 10px;
}

a.lienurl, li a.lienurl {
	display: inline;
	line-height:18px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: underline;
	color: #526678;
	font-size: 10px;
	background: url(images/pic_link.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
.lienpdf {
	display: block;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: underline;
	color: #526678;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
li a.lienpdf {
	display: inline;
	line-height:18px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: underline;
	color: #526678;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
.lienpdf:hover {
	display: block;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#0000FF;
	text-decoration: none;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
.lienpdf2{
	margin-left:80px;
	display: block;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: underline;
	color: #0033CC;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}


.lienpdf2:hover {
	margin-left:80px;
	display: block;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#0000FF;
	text-decoration: none;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
.lienpdf3{
	margin-left:10px;
/*	display: block;*/
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: underline;
	color: #0033CC;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
.lienpdf3:hover{
	margin-left:10px;
/*	display: block;*/
	font-family: Verdana, Arial, Helvetica, sans-serif;
	text-decoration: none;
	color: #0033CC;
	font-size: 10px;
	background: url(images/pdf2.gif) no-repeat;
	padding: 2px 0px 2px 20px;
}
hr {
	border: none;
	border-bottom: solid 1px #000;
}
input {
	border: 1px solid #FFA921;
	font-size: 10px
}
/* --------------------------------------- menu de gauche -------------------------------------------*/
dl#menu {
	width: 171px;
	font-size: 10px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old; 
	margin-bottom:0;
}
/* 1er niveau : energie, déchets... */
dt.menu1, dt.menu2, dt.menu3, dt.menu4, dt.menu5 {
	color: #fff;
	margin: 0px 0 0 0;
	padding: 5 5 5 5px;
	line-height: 15px;
	cursor: pointer; /* On met ici le type de curseur pointer (la main qui apparaît sur les liens) pour indiquer au webnaute qu'il y a une action quelconque à faire, donc qu'il faut cliquer */
	border-bottom: 1px solid #90BADE;
	background-color:#2175BC;
	}
dt.menu1 {
	border-left: 10px solid #CACC02;
	border-bottom: 1px solid #CACC02;
	cursor: pointer; 
	}
dt.menu2 {
	border-left: 10px solid #6699CC;
	border-bottom: 1px solid #6699CC;
	}
dt.menu3 {
	border-left: 10px solid #FF9999;
	border-bottom: 1px solid #FF9999;
	}
dt.menu4 {
	border-left: 10px solid #FF9900;
	border-bottom: 1px solid #FF9900;
	}
dt.menu5 {
	border-left: 10px solid #FF007A;
	border-bottom: 1px solid #FF007A;
	}
	
/* 2è niveau */
dl#menu dt, dl#menu li {
	cursor: pointer;
} dl[id=menu] dt, dl[id=menu] li { cursor: pointer; }

dd#smenu1{
	margin: 0;
	padding: 0px 0px 0px 0px;
	border-right: 1px solid #eca;
	border-bottom: 1px solid #eca;
	background: #5BA3E0;
	border-left: 10px solid #CACC02;
}
dl#menu dd ul li{
	color:FFFFFF;
	font-weight:bold;
	border-left:10px solid #5BA3E0;		
}
dd#smenu2 {
	margin: 0;
	padding: 0px 0px 0px 0px;
	border-right: 1px solid #eca;
	border-bottom: 1px solid #eca;
	background: #5BA3E0;
	border-left: 10px solid #6699CC;
}
dd#smenu3 {
	margin: 0;
	padding: 0px 0px 0px 0px;
	border-right: 1px solid #eca;
	border-bottom: 1px solid #eca;
	background: #5BA3E0;
	border-left: 10px solid #FF9999;
}
dd#smenu4 {
	margin: 0;
	padding: 0px 0px 0px 0px;
	border-right: 1px solid #eca;
	border-bottom: 1px solid #eca;
	background: #5BA3E0;
	border-left: 10px solid #FF9900;
}
dd#smenu5 {
	margin: 0;
	padding: 0px 0px 0px 0px;
	border-right: 1px solid #eca;
	border-bottom: 1px solid #eca;
	background: #5BA3E0;
	border-left: 10px solid #FF007A;
}
dl#menu dd ul {
	margin: 0;
	padding: 0;
}
dl#menu dd ul li {
	margin: 0;
	padding: 0;
	list-style-type: none;
	line-height:18px;
}
dl#menu dd ul li a {
	width: 100%;
	font-weight:bold;
	font-size: 10px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#fff;
	text-decoration: none;
	padding-left: 0px;
}
dl#menu dd ul ul li a {
	width: 100%;
	font-weight:normal;
	font-size: 10px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#fff;
	text-decoration: none;
	padding-left: 5px;
	line-height:15px;
}
dl#menu dd ul ul li a:hover {
	width: 100%;
	padding-left: 5px;
	color:#1958B7;
}
.LienCache {
	display:none;
}

/* -------------------------------------------partie de droite qui bouge avec le scroll ----------------------------------*/

#CC {
	RIGHT: 0px;
	WIDTH: 126px;
	POSITION: absolute;
	TOP: -2px;


}
.links {
	FONT-SIZE: 12px; COLOR: #660099; FONT-FAMILY: verdana,arial,helvetica,sans-serif; TEXT-DECORATION: underline
}
A.links:link {
	FONT-SIZE: 12px; COLOR: #660099; FONT-FAMILY: verdana,arial,helvetica,sans-serif; TEXT-DECORATION: none
}
A.links:hover {
	FONT-SIZE: 12px; COLOR: #660099; FONT-FAMILY: verdana,arial,helvetica,sans-serif; TEXT-DECORATION: none
}
A.links:active {
	FONT-SIZE: 12px; COLOR: #660099; FONT-FAMILY: verdana,arial,helvetica,sans-serif; TEXT-DECORATION: none
}
A.links:visited {
	FONT-SIZE: 12px; COLOR: #660099; FONT-FAMILY: verdana,arial,helvetica,sans-serif; TEXT-DECORATION: none
}
.archives {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ight: bold;
	color: #000066;
	border:none;
}
.radio {
	background-color: #FFFFFF;
	color: #CC0000;
	border-top: 1px solid #FFFFFF;
	border-right: 1px solid #C3DFFA;
	border-bottom: 1px solid #C3DFFA;
	border-left: 1px solid #FFFFFF;
}.titrePlan {

font:bold 10px verdana;
}
.textPlan {

font:10px verdana;
}
.centre a:visited{
	color:#526678;
}

li.sommaire {
	list-style: none;
}
